Flutter Dart news
142 subscribers
216 photos
24 videos
11 files
79 links
Download Telegram
#update Yangilanish mavjud

Assalomu aleykum


#android:
https://play.google.com/store/apps/details?id=com.triada.tiictactoe


#web:
https://play.google.com/apps/testing/com.triada.tiictactoe

TicTacToe o'yini, Feedbacklarni kutib qolaman โœŠ๐Ÿป

iloji bo'lsa izohlar qoldirsangiz xursand bo'lar edim ๐Ÿ˜Š
๐Ÿ˜…๐Ÿ˜…
๐Ÿ˜5๐Ÿ‘2๐Ÿ‘1
Flutter Dart news
DarkMode da yangi ui ๐Ÿ˜…๐Ÿ˜… Bugun kechga update chiqadi nasib qilsa!
โ€ผ๏ธbunaqa tez tez yangilanish chiqarishimni sababi bor:
#Play #Console ni bazi qoidalarini o'qib qoldim testing jarayonida update chiqarish kerak ekan ,bazi akkauntlarni kordim testingdan o'tgan ammo testing jarayonida #update(yangilanish) chiqarmagani uchun 2-3 kun dan so'ng akkaunt terminated(ban olgan) bo'lgan
Bugungi kun:
1) Uyg'onish ๐Ÿ•Ÿ 06:00-06:30
2) Badantarbiya ๐Ÿƒ๐Ÿปโ€โ™‚๏ธ 06:30 - 06:45
3) Ertalabki dush ๐Ÿšฟ
4) Nonushta ๐Ÿฝ 07:00 - 07:15
5) Mobile o'yin ๐ŸŽฎ 07:20 - 07:45
6) Ishga tayyorgarlik ๐Ÿ‘จ๐Ÿปโ€๐Ÿ’ป 07:45 - 08:00
7) Ish vaqti ๐Ÿ‘จ๐Ÿปโ€๐Ÿ’ป 09:00 - 18:00
8) Suzish ๐ŸŠ๐Ÿปโ€โ™‚๏ธ 18:30 - 19:40
9) Kechki tamaddi 20:00 - 20:10
10) Dam olish 20:10 - 20:50
11) Foundation kursim 21:00 - 22:10
12) Mobile o'yin ๐ŸŽฎ 23:00 gacha

So'ngra uyqu vaqti ๐Ÿ˜ด
Assalomu aleykum
๐ŸŽ“ Kuchaytirilgan OOP kursini BOOTCAMP shaklida o'rganing!

GITA dasturchilar akademiyasi 3 oylik OOP kursini 1 oy ichida kuchaytirilgan tartibda o'rganishni taklif qiladi.

๐ŸŽ 10 nafar iqtidorli yoshlarga bu kursni mutlaqo bepul o'qish imkoniyatini beramiz.

Agar siz dasturlash asoslarini oโ€˜rgangan boโ€˜lsangiz va endi Object-Oriented Programming (OOP) ni chuqur oโ€˜zlashtirmoqchi boโ€˜lsangiz โ€” bu imkoniyat aynan siz uchun!

โœ… Tanlovda qatnashish uchun talablar:
1. Dasturlash asoslarini bilish (istalgan dasturlash tilida)
2. Haftasiga 5 kun, kuniga 3 soatlik darslarda qatnasha olish
3. Toshkent shahri, Yunusobod tumanida darslarga kelish imkoniyati
4. O'quvchi 17 - 25 yosh oralig'ida bo'lishi.

๐Ÿงช Saralash qanday boโ€˜ladi?
Nomzodlar berilgan masalalarni yechish orqali saralanadi โ€” biz sizdan fikrlash, algoritmlash va oโ€˜rganishga tayyorlikni koโ€˜rmoqchimiz.

๐Ÿ‘‰ Tanlovda ishtirok etish uchun ro'yxatdan o'ting.

๐Ÿ“… Tanlov 19.04.2025 sanada bo'lib o'tadi.
๐Ÿ“Manzil: Toshkent sh. Yunusobod tumani,
Amir Temur 129b, Anor Plaza 4-qavat.
Mo'ljal: Shaxriston metrosi

๐Ÿ‘จ๐Ÿปโ€๐Ÿ’ป Admin bilan aloqa
๐Ÿ“ž +998-90-808-37-38

๐Ÿ“ข Telegram | ๐ŸŽฅ Youtube | ๐Ÿ“ธInstagram |
Forwarded from Sherzodbek Muhammadiev
Assalomu alaykum, yaxshimisizlar?
Dasturlashni endi boshlaganlar uchun OOP ni 100% grand asosida o'qitishni e'lon qilgan edik. Shu habarni endi o'rganishni boshlayotgan iqtidorli o'rganuvchilarga yetib borishida yordam bersangiz degan umidda edim. Avvaldan niyat qilar edim, lekin ko'pchilikka bera olmagan edik, bu safar 10 kishiga imkon qila oldik.
Uzr mavzudan tashqari habar uchun.

"GITA dasturchilar akademiyasi 3 oylik OOP kursini 1 oy ichida kuchaytirilgan tartibda o'rganishni taklif qiladi.

๐ŸŽ 10 nafar iqtidorli yoshlarga bu kursni mutlaqo bepul o'qish imkoniyatini beramiz."

#grand #oop #tafsiya

To'liq ma'lumot uchun
๐Ÿ”ฅ3
Bugungi 700 m ga suzish ๐ŸŠโ€โ™‚๏ธ dan soโ€™ng hayotga boโ€™lgan qiziqish soโ€™ndi,bu koโ€™ngil faqat uyqu istar ๐Ÿ˜…
๐Ÿ˜5
Bugungi kun:

1) Uygโ€™onish โฑ๏ธ 06:30
2) Nonushta โ˜•๏ธ06:40-06:55
3)Ijtimoiy tarmoq ๐Ÿ›œ 07:00-07:15
4)Mobile oโ€™yin ๐ŸŽฎ07:15 - 07:50
5)Ishga tayyorgarlik ๐Ÿ‘จโ€๐Ÿ’ป
6)Ish ๐Ÿ’ผ 09:00 - 18:00
7) Suzishdan oldingi tamaddi ๐Ÿฅช
8)Suzish ๐ŸŠโ€โ™‚๏ธ 18:30 - 19:50
9๏ธโƒฃ0๏ธโƒฃ0๏ธโƒฃ m ga suzish
9) Kechki tamaddi ๐Ÿฅ— 20:30 - 20:50
10) Dam olish ๐Ÿ›๏ธ
11) Flutter kurs ๐Ÿ‘จโ€๐Ÿ’ป 21:00 -
12) Uyqu vaqti 23:00 dan soโ€™ng ๐Ÿ’ค๐Ÿ˜ด
๐Ÿ”ฅ3
This media is not supported in your browser
VIEW IN TELEGRAM
Nimanidir eslatmayaptimi ๐Ÿ˜…
๐Ÿ˜1
๐Ÿฅณ๐Ÿฅณ๐Ÿ†๐Ÿ†๐Ÿฅ‡๐Ÿฅ‡
๐Ÿ‘2
Assalomu aleykum barchaga!

Oramizda #Play #Console (Play Market) ga yangi developer accaunt ochganlar diqqatiga โ€ผ๏ธโ€ผ๏ธ

Agar ilovangiz test jarayonidan o'tgan ammo publishga chiqishiga 3 kundan ko'p vaqt olayotgan bo'lsa #Play #Console bilan bog'laning nega bunday ko'p vaqt olayotganini so'rang so'ng ular sizga aloqaga chiqishadi.
Siz qoygan proyektda 3-tomon SDK yoki code lari bo'lsa publish jarayoni shunday uzoq vaqt olar ekan.agar 3-tomon kodlari bolsa va u kodlar #litsenziyalangan bo'lsa siz muallifdan ruxsat olishingiz va ushbu ruxsatnomani #Play #Console ga taqdim etishingiz kerak .

Bugun menda ayni shunday holat yuz berdi.So'ng men ular so'ragan hujjatlarni yubordim shundan song ular appni yana qayta korib chiqishmoqda!

โ€ผ๏ธโ€ผ๏ธ
Meni bilishimcha agar 3-tomon kodlari yoki SDk si bolsa sizning proyektingizda bu #Akkauntingiz blocklanishiga(Yoki app publish bo'lmasligiga) olib keladi !!Agar tegishli hujjatlarni yuklamasangiz !
๐Ÿ‘3
Forwarded from MobilDasturchi.Uz (Azizbek Asqaraliyev)
๐Ÿ“ข DIQQAT, iOS developerlar!

๐Ÿ—“ 10-may kuni, soat 18:00 dan boshlab (Oโ€˜zbekiston vaqti bilan) App Store Connect texnik ishlar sababli 2 soatgacha vaqtga ishlamaydi.

โ— Shuning uchun muhim yuklamalar (deliveries) yoki oโ€˜zgarishlaringizni 18:00 dan oldin amalga oshirib qoโ€˜ying.

โฑ Vaqt: 10-may, 06:00 PDT = 10-may, 18:00 Oโ€˜zbekiston vaqti
๐Ÿ”ง Texnik xizmat davomiyligi: taxminan 2 soat
Ma'lumotni himoyalang!


๐Ÿ“ฑ Flutter ilovangizda siz istagan screenlarda #screenshot qilishni cheklash uchun:

1) ๐Ÿ‘‰ #no_screenshot paketidan foydalanamiz

dependencies:
flutter:
sdk: flutter
no_screenshot: ^version


2) Maxfiy ekranda #screenshot ni blocklash:

import 'package:flutter/material.dart';
import 'package:no_screenshot/no_screenshot.dart';

class SecureScreen extends StatefulWidget {
const SecureScreen({super.key});

@override
State<SecureScreen> createState() => _SecureScreenState();
}

class _SecureScreenState extends State<SecureScreen> {
final NoScreenshot noScreenshot = NoScreenshot();

@override
void initState() {
super.initState();
_enableSecureMode();
}

Future<void> _enableSecureMode() async {
await noScreenshot.screenshotOff();
}

@override
void dispose() {
noScreenshot.screenshotOn();
super.dispose();
}

@override
Widget build(BuildContext context) {
return Scaffold(
appBar: AppBar(
title: const Text("Maxfiy ma'lumotlar"),
),
body: const Center(
child: Text('Bu ekranda screenshot olish taqiqlangan.'),
),
);
}
}



#Eslatma

Agar maxsus #screen ni #screenshot qilishdan blocklamoqchi bolsangiz #initState da screenshotni #off qiling #dispose da esa yana screenshotni #on qilib qoyasiz! Screenshotni #no_screenshot package bilan cheklash #system darajasida bo'ladi โ•Shuning uchun #dispose da uni #on qilishni unutmangโ€ผ๏ธ
1๐Ÿ‘5